What Is Arc Raiders?

Arc Raiders is Embark Studios’ take on the extraction shooter genre, but calling it “just another extraction shooter” would be doing it a massive disservice. Set in a post-apocalyptic world where mysterious mechanized threats called ARC have taken over the surface, players take on the role of “Raiders” who venture topside to gather resources, fight both AI enemies and other players, and extract safely with their loot.

What immediately struck me about Arc Raiders is how accessible it feels compared to other extraction shooters. The game features a unique blend of cooperative and competitive gameplay that somehow manages to appeal to both hardcore PvP enthusiasts and players who prefer a more cooperative experience. It’s available on PC (Steam), PlayStation 5, and Xbox Series X|S, with full cross-play support, which definitely contributes to its massive player base.

The game launched on October 30, 2025, and has already sold over 4 million copies worldwide, making it “the most successful global launch in Nexon’s history.” That’s not just impressive—that’s record-breaking stuff right there.

Arc Raiders Player Count Breakdown?

Let’s dive into the numbers, because they’re honestly staggering. As of mid-November 2025, Arc Raiders has reached some incredible milestones:

PC (Steam) Player Count

  • Current Players: 386,652
  • 24-Hour Peak: 433,355
  • All-Time Peak: 475,913

These Steam numbers alone would be impressive for any game, but for a paid extraction shooter? That’s unheard of. To put this in perspective, Arc Raiders has surpassed even massive titles like Helldivers 2 in terms of concurrent Steam players.

Console Player Count

While exact console numbers are harder to track, Embark Studios revealed that Arc Raiders crossed the 700,000 concurrent player mark across all platforms. With Steam players accounting for around 460,000 of that peak, that means we’re looking at approximately 240,000+ concurrent players on P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X|S combined.

Sales Figures

The game has sold over 4 million copies worldwide since launch. This makes it not just a commercial success but “the most successful global launch in Nexon’s history.” When you consider that the game costs around $40 for the standard edition, those numbers become even more impressive.

Growth Trends

What’s particularly encouraging is the growth trajectory. In the last 30 days, Arc Raiders has seen a 32.8% increase in average players, going from 186,788 in October to 248,052 in November. This isn’t just a launch spike—this is sustained growth, which is incredibly rare in today’s competitive gaming landscape.

The Surprising Player Behavior Patterns

Here’s where things get really interesting. According to a fascinating analysis by PC Gamer, Arc Raiders has developed a uniquely non-hostile culture compared to other extraction shooters. The data they uncovered is pretty mind-blowing:

  • Only 42.3% of Steam players have the “Unyielding” achievement (knock out 10 raiders)
  • This means 57.7% of players barely engage with PvP at all
  • Even more surprisingly, 19% of players have never even killed another player

These numbers are practically unheard of in the extraction shooter genre. In most games of this type, PvP is not just encouraged—it’s practically required for progression. The fact that more than half of Arc Raiders’ player base chooses to avoid PvP whenever possible suggests that the game has successfully created a different kind of experience.

What’s even more fascinating is that the exact same percentage of players (81.3%) who have engaged in PvP have also participated in cooperative activities like sharing elevators back to safety. This suggests that while PvP is certainly an option, many players are choosing cooperation over competition.

I think this speaks volumes about Arc Raiders’ design philosophy. The game doesn’t force players into aggressive playstyles. Instead, it gives them the freedom to choose how they want to play, whether that’s going in guns-blazing, focusing on PvE content, or somewhere in between. This flexibility is likely a major factor in the game’s broad appeal and sustained player count.

Tips & Tricks for New Players

If you’re thinking about joining the 700,000+ players already enjoying Arc Raiders, here are some tips I’ve picked up during my time with the game:

Start with PvE

Don’t feel pressured to engage in PvP right away. Spend your first few raids focusing on learning the maps, understanding the ARC enemy patterns, and getting comfortable with the extraction mechanics. The PvE content is robust enough to stand on its own.

Learn the Extraction Points

Nothing’s worse than surviving a tough raid only to get lost trying to find the extraction point. Take some time to learn where the extraction zones are on each map. This knowledge will save you countless headaches (and lost loot) down the line.

Don’t Hoard Everything

It’s tempting to grab every piece of loot you see, but remember that you can only extract with what you can carry. Focus on high-value items and essentials rather than trying to collect everything in sight.

Communication is Key

Whether you’re playing with friends or encountering random players, communication can make the difference between a successful extraction and a lost raid. Even simple callouts about enemy positions or loot locations can be incredibly helpful.

Experiment with Different Loadouts

Arc Raiders offers a variety of weapons and equipment options. Don’t be afraid to experiment with different loadouts to find what works best for your playstyle. You might discover that you prefer a more stealthy approach or that you excel with certain weapon types.
